| Metric | Amador High | Pioneer Magnet School for the Visual and Performing Arts |
|---|---|---|
| Enrollment | 702 | 153 |
| Student-Teacher Ratio | 20.9:1 | 21.1:1 |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 35.2% | 55.6% |
| Diversity | Diverse | Diverse |
| School Type | Regular High School | Regular Combined School |
| Locale | Unknown | Unknown |
